Top 5 Basketball Games on iOS in Germany: Q2 2021 Performance

In the second quarter of 2021, the top 5 basketball game apps on iOS in Germany showed varying trends in downloads, revenue, and active user metrics. Here’s a detailed look at their performance based on Sensor Tower data.

Jump Dunk 3D experienced a fluctuating trend in weekly downloads, starting at around 2.7K at the beginning of April and peaking at 4.8K by the end of the month. Downloads dipped to 1.0K in mid-June before rising again to approximately 2.7K by the end of the quarter. Weekly active users followed a similar pattern, peaking at 9.6K in late April and dropping to 4.3K in mid-June, before ending the quarter at 6.4K.

Flipper Dunk saw a gradual decrease in weekly downloads from 3.4K at the end of March to around 1.0K in mid-May. However, downloads rebounded to 2.5K by early June. Revenue showed a similar fluctuating trend, with peaks and troughs throughout the quarter, reaching up to $33 in the last week of June. Weekly active users also varied, starting at 10.3K and ending at 8.3K, with a peak of 11.3K in early April.

Basketball Arena - Sports Game had a notable decline in weekly downloads from 5.0K in late March to around 1.1K by the end of May. Downloads recovered slightly to 1.5K by the end of June. Revenue peaked at $1.9K in early April and saw a dip, fluctuating around $1.0K towards the end of the quarter. Active users decreased from 23.1K at the end of March to 7.9K by the end of June.

NBA 2K Mobile Basketball Game showed a consistent pattern in weekly downloads, starting at 1.1K at the end of March and peaking at nearly 2.1K in mid-April. Revenue was highest in early April at around $3.5K, with a general decline to $1.7K by the end of June. Active users saw a peak of 5.8K in mid-April, ending the quarter at 5.3K.

Lastly, Basketball Stars™: Multiplayer had a relatively stable download rate, starting at 1.2K in late March and slightly dropping to around 0.6K by the end of the quarter. Revenue peaked at $1.2K in mid-April but fell significantly to $90 by the end of June. Active users started at 12.0K in late March and ended at 4.3K in late June, with a noticeable drop throughout the quarter.
